What is Olive Leaf?
Olive leaf is derived from the leaves of the olive tree, scientifically known as Olea europaea. The olive tree is native to the Mediterranean region and has been cultivated for thousands of years for its fruit and oil. Olive leaf has been used for centuries in traditional medicine to prevent and treat various health conditions, thanks to its potent antioxidant and anti-inflammatory properties.
Key Components of Olive Leaf
Olive leaf contains several key components that contribute to its health benefits. One of the most important of these is Oleuropein, which has been shown to have anti-viral, anti-bacterial, and anti-fungal properties. This makes it a powerful natural remedy for fighting infections and boosting the immune system. Olive leaf also contains Flavonoids, which have antioxidant and anti-inflammatory properties. These compounds help to protect the body against oxidative stress and inflammation, which can contribute to a range of chronic diseases. Another important component of olive leaf is Hydroxytyrosol, which is a potent antioxidant that has been shown to have anti-cancer properties.

Dosage and Safety Guidelines
It is essential to follow dosage guidelines when incorporating olive leaf into your dog’s diet. The recommended dosage will vary depending on your dog’s size and health status, so it is best to consult with a veterinarian before starting your dog on a new supplement.
It is also important to start with a lower dose and gradually increase it over time. This will help your dog’s body adjust to the new supplement and reduce the risk of any potential side effects.
If your dog is already on medication, it is recommended to consult with a veterinarian before giving them olive leaf supplements. While olive leaf is generally safe for dogs to consume, it can interact with certain medications and cause adverse effects.
